Job Summary

We are seeking an Event Coordinator to organize and support the planning and execution of company events promotional programs and marketing activities. This role is responsible for coordinating event details maintaining schedules organizing resources and helping ensure each event is delivered efficiently and professionally.

The Event Coordinator will work closely with marketing operations and other internal teams throughout the event process. This position is well suited for someone who is highly organized detail-oriented and comfortable managing multiple timelines and priorities.

Responsibilities

  • Coordinate the planning and execution of events and promotional activities
  • Develop and maintain event schedules timelines and planning documents
  • Coordinate event locations materials supplies and logistical requirements
  • Organize event setup breakdown and on-site operational needs
  • Maintain calendars and track important event deadlines and deliverables
  • Coordinate promotional materials and other resources needed for upcoming events
  • Communicate event details schedules and responsibilities to participating team members
  • Work with marketing and operations teams to ensure event requirements are completed on time
  • Coordinate with venues suppliers and service providers when applicable
  • Monitor event activities and address logistical needs during execution
  • Maintain organized records of event details participation and activities
  • Assist with tracking event expenses and resource requirements
  • Gather attendee feedback and other relevant information following events
  • Prepare basic event summaries and assist with post-event reporting
  • Identify opportunities to improve event organization and future execution
  • Support additional event marketing and promotional projects as needed
